Not accounting for tastes and preferences, but it is decidedly not true that tmux does everything Zellij does (just some very minor examples are: true floating panes, true multiplayer support, stacked panes, etc.)

As for prevalence: this very often has to do with the distributions themselves and their ability to accept certain (rust) dependencies.

Otherwise though, I always say Zellij is not competing with tmux. That tool choices should be more equivalent to clothing choices than to choosing a school for your kids. Choose what you like, there should not be religious disagreements here.
